| Time | Implementation | Compiler | Benchmark date | SUPERCOP version |
| 648948 | ref | gcc -m64 -march=core2 -msse4.1 -O2 -fomit-frame-pointer | 20120112 | 20111120 |
| 649860 | ref | gcc -m64 -march=core2 -msse4 -O2 -fomit-frame-pointer | 20120112 | 20111120 |
| 650190 | ref | gcc -m64 -march=native -mtune=native -O2 -fomit-frame-pointer | 20120112 | 20111120 |
| 678177 | ref | gcc -m64 -march=core2 -O2 -fomit-frame-pointer | 20120112 | 20111120 |
| 704004 | ref | gcc -m64 -march=core2 -O3 -fomit-frame-pointer | 20120112 | 20111120 |
| 704058 | ref | gcc -m64 -march=core2 -msse4.1 -O3 -fomit-frame-pointer | 20120112 | 20111120 |
| 704289 | ref | gcc -march=k8 -O3 -fomit-frame-pointer | 20120112 | 20111120 |
| 704898 | ref | gcc -m64 -march=native -mtune=native -O3 -fomit-frame-pointer | 20120112 | 20111120 |
| 705774 | ref | gcc -m64 -march=k8 -O3 -fomit-frame-pointer | 20120112 | 20111120 |
| 706155 | ref | gcc -m64 -march=core2 -msse4 -O3 -fomit-frame-pointer | 20120112 | 20111120 |
| 725361 | ref | gcc -O3 -fomit-frame-pointer | 20120112 | 20111120 |
| 734292 | ref | gcc -fno-schedule-insns -O3 -fomit-frame-pointer | 20120112 | 20111120 |
| 737493 | ref | gcc -m64 -O3 -fomit-frame-pointer | 20120112 | 20111120 |
| 741870 | ref | gcc -funroll-loops -m64 -march=barcelona -O3 -fomit-frame-pointer | 20120112 | 20111120 |
| 744561 | ref | gcc -m64 -march=core2 -msse4.1 -Os -fomit-frame-pointer | 20120112 | 20111120 |
| 744828 | ref | gcc -m64 -march=native -mtune=native -Os -fomit-frame-pointer | 20120112 | 20111120 |
| 745800 | ref | gcc -m64 -march=barcelona -O3 -fomit-frame-pointer | 20120112 | 20111120 |
| 746427 | ref | gcc -m64 -march=core2 -msse4 -Os -fomit-frame-pointer | 20120112 | 20111120 |
| 746892 | ref | gcc -m64 -march=barcelona -O3 -fomit-frame-pointer | 20120112 | 20111120 |
| 746910 | ref | gcc -m64 -march=core2 -Os -fomit-frame-pointer | 20120112 | 20111120 |
| 748587 | ref | gcc -march=barcelona -O3 -fomit-frame-pointer | 20120112 | 20111120 |
| 753600 | ref | gcc -funroll-loops -m64 -march=k8 -O3 -fomit-frame-pointer | 20120112 | 20111120 |
| 754929 | ref | gcc -funroll-loops -march=k8 -O3 -fomit-frame-pointer | 20120112 | 20111120 |
| 755484 | ref | gcc -funroll-loops -march=barcelona -O3 -fomit-frame-pointer | 20120112 | 20111120 |
| 770511 | ref | gcc -m64 -march=core2 -msse4.1 -O -fomit-frame-pointer | 20120112 | 20111120 |
| 772773 | ref | gcc -m64 -march=core2 -O -fomit-frame-pointer | 20120112 | 20111120 |
| 773487 | ref | gcc -m64 -march=core2 -msse4 -O -fomit-frame-pointer | 20120112 | 20111120 |
| 777060 | ref | gcc -m64 -march=native -mtune=native -O -fomit-frame-pointer | 20120112 | 20111120 |
| 808803 | ref | gcc -funroll-loops -O3 -fomit-frame-pointer | 20120112 | 20111120 |
| 812058 | ref | gcc -funroll-loops -m64 -O3 -fomit-frame-pointer | 20120112 | 20111120 |
| 815808 | ref | gcc -funroll-loops -fno-schedule-insns -O3 -fomit-frame-pointer | 20120112 | 20111120 |
| 866415 | ref | gcc -funroll-loops -m64 -march=nocona -O3 -fomit-frame-pointer | 20120112 | 20111120 |
| 867987 | ref | gcc -funroll-loops -march=nocona -O3 -fomit-frame-pointer | 20120112 | 20111120 |
| 881001 | ref | gcc -m64 -march=nocona -O3 -fomit-frame-pointer | 20120112 | 20111120 |
| 883362 | ref | gcc -march=nocona -O3 -fomit-frame-pointer | 20120112 | 20111120 |
| 994077 | ref | gcc -funroll-loops -march=barcelona -O2 -fomit-frame-pointer | 20120112 | 20111120 |
| 996252 | ref | gcc -funroll-loops -m64 -march=nocona -O2 -fomit-frame-pointer | 20120112 | 20111120 |
| 996315 | ref | gcc -funroll-loops -m64 -march=k8 -O2 -fomit-frame-pointer | 20120112 | 20111120 |
| 996609 | ref | gcc -funroll-loops -march=k8 -O2 -fomit-frame-pointer | 20120112 | 20111120 |
| 997350 | ref | gcc -funroll-loops -m64 -march=barcelona -O2 -fomit-frame-pointer | 20120112 | 20111120 |
| 997605 | ref | gcc -funroll-loops -march=nocona -O2 -fomit-frame-pointer | 20120112 | 20111120 |
| 1003266 | ref | gcc -funroll-loops -O2 -fomit-frame-pointer | 20120112 | 20111120 |
| 1003395 | ref | gcc -funroll-loops -fno-schedule-insns -O2 -fomit-frame-pointer | 20120112 | 20111120 |
| 1004370 | ref | gcc -funroll-loops -m64 -O2 -fomit-frame-pointer | 20120112 | 20111120 |
| 1019673 | ref | gcc -funroll-loops -m64 -march=k8 -O -fomit-frame-pointer | 20120112 | 20111120 |
| 1020681 | ref | gcc -funroll-loops -m64 -march=barcelona -O -fomit-frame-pointer | 20120112 | 20111120 |
| 1021410 | ref | gcc -funroll-loops -march=k8 -O -fomit-frame-pointer | 20120112 | 20111120 |
| 1022283 | ref | gcc -funroll-loops -march=barcelona -O -fomit-frame-pointer | 20120112 | 20111120 |
| 1026036 | ref | gcc -m64 -march=barcelona -O2 -fomit-frame-pointer | 20120112 | 20111120 |
| 1030359 | ref | gcc -m64 -march=barcelona -O2 -fomit-frame-pointer | 20120112 | 20111120 |
| 1031790 | ref | gcc -funroll-loops -fno-schedule-insns -O -fomit-frame-pointer | 20120112 | 20111120 |
| 1032213 | ref | gcc -march=barcelona -O2 -fomit-frame-pointer | 20120112 | 20111120 |
| 1033035 | ref | gcc -funroll-loops -m64 -O -fomit-frame-pointer | 20120112 | 20111120 |
| 1037580 | ref | gcc -funroll-loops -O -fomit-frame-pointer | 20120112 | 20111120 |
| 1041153 | ref | gcc -m64 -march=k8 -O2 -fomit-frame-pointer | 20120112 | 20111120 |
| 1043901 | ref | gcc -funroll-loops -march=nocona -O -fomit-frame-pointer | 20120112 | 20111120 |
| 1044786 | ref | gcc -funroll-loops -m64 -march=nocona -O -fomit-frame-pointer | 20120112 | 20111120 |
| 1046505 | ref | gcc -march=k8 -O2 -fomit-frame-pointer | 20120112 | 20111120 |
| 1061670 | ref | gcc -fno-schedule-insns -O2 -fomit-frame-pointer | 20120112 | 20111120 |
| 1071840 | ref | gcc -O2 -fomit-frame-pointer | 20120112 | 20111120 |
| 1074402 | ref | gcc -m64 -O2 -fomit-frame-pointer | 20120112 | 20111120 |
| 1172457 | ref | gcc -O -fomit-frame-pointer | 20120112 | 20111120 |
| 1178055 | ref | gcc -m64 -march=barcelona -O -fomit-frame-pointer | 20120112 | 20111120 |
| 1178835 | ref | gcc -march=barcelona -O -fomit-frame-pointer | 20120112 | 20111120 |
| 1181391 | ref | gcc -m64 -O -fomit-frame-pointer | 20120112 | 20111120 |
| 1184670 | ref | gcc -fno-schedule-insns -O -fomit-frame-pointer | 20120112 | 20111120 |
| 1188207 | ref | gcc -march=nocona -O2 -fomit-frame-pointer | 20120112 | 20111120 |
| 1193019 | ref | gcc -march=k8 -O -fomit-frame-pointer | 20120112 | 20111120 |
| 1193397 | ref | gcc -m64 -march=barcelona -O -fomit-frame-pointer | 20120112 | 20111120 |
| 1195596 | ref | gcc -m64 -march=k8 -O -fomit-frame-pointer | 20120112 | 20111120 |
| 1203075 | ref | gcc -m64 -march=nocona -O2 -fomit-frame-pointer | 20120112 | 20111120 |
| 1204728 | ref | gcc -m64 -march=nocona -O -fomit-frame-pointer | 20120112 | 20111120 |
| 1211364 | ref | gcc -march=nocona -O -fomit-frame-pointer | 20120112 | 20111120 |
| 1213599 | ref | gcc -m64 -Os -fomit-frame-pointer | 20120112 | 20111120 |
| 1223109 | ref | gcc -Os -fomit-frame-pointer | 20120112 | 20111120 |
| 1227357 | ref | gcc -funroll-loops -m64 -march=nocona -Os -fomit-frame-pointer | 20120112 | 20111120 |
| 1230750 | ref | gcc -march=barcelona -Os -fomit-frame-pointer | 20120112 | 20111120 |
| 1231875 | ref | gcc -m64 -march=barcelona -Os -fomit-frame-pointer | 20120112 | 20111120 |
| 1232877 | ref | gcc -fno-schedule-insns -Os -fomit-frame-pointer | 20120112 | 20111120 |
| 1233060 | ref | gcc -m64 -march=k8 -Os -fomit-frame-pointer | 20120112 | 20111120 |
| 1233147 | ref | gcc -funroll-loops -march=nocona -Os -fomit-frame-pointer | 20120112 | 20111120 |
| 1233618 | ref | gcc -m64 -march=barcelona -Os -fomit-frame-pointer | 20120112 | 20111120 |
| 1233831 | ref | gcc -march=k8 -Os -fomit-frame-pointer | 20120112 | 20111120 |
| 1257627 | ref | gcc -funroll-loops -march=barcelona -Os -fomit-frame-pointer | 20120112 | 20111120 |
| 1259823 | ref | gcc -funroll-loops -m64 -Os -fomit-frame-pointer | 20120112 | 20111120 |
| 1260114 | ref | gcc -funroll-loops -m64 -march=k8 -Os -fomit-frame-pointer | 20120112 | 20111120 |
| 1260741 | ref | gcc -funroll-loops -Os -fomit-frame-pointer | 20120112 | 20111120 |
| 1262721 | ref | gcc -funroll-loops -fno-schedule-insns -Os -fomit-frame-pointer | 20120112 | 20111120 |
| 1264857 | ref | gcc -funroll-loops -m64 -march=barcelona -Os -fomit-frame-pointer | 20120112 | 20111120 |
| 1268556 | ref | gcc -funroll-loops -march=k8 -Os -fomit-frame-pointer | 20120112 | 20111120 |
| 1291131 | ref | gcc -march=nocona -Os -fomit-frame-pointer | 20120112 | 20111120 |
| 1292868 | ref | gcc -m64 -march=nocona -Os -fomit-frame-pointer | 20120112 | 20111120 |
| 3366918 | ref | gcc -funroll-loops | 20120112 | 20111120 |
| 3372882 | ref | cc | 20120112 | 20111120 |
| 3375156 | ref | gcc | 20120112 | 20111120 |